Fighting Corruption

Political money corruption occurs in the presidency and in Congress where influence-seeking, big donors are rewarded with government decisions and actions. President Trump has abused his office to enrich himself and his family by billions of dollars so far in his second term.

  • We fight presidential, congressional and executive branch corruption.
  • We file complaints with and request investigations by the Justice Department and the Federal Election Commission challenging violations of the campaign finance laws by Democrats and Republicans. We challenge executive branch officials for abuses of office and for using public office for personal financial goal.
  • We support congressional investigations to prevent foreign interference in our elections and protect the integrity and honesty of elections.
  • We develop and advocate legislation to prevent the corrupting influence of big money in American politics and to prevent foreign governments from corrupting our elections.
